Job Description - Client Reporting Analyst

Firm Overview:

Cambridge Associates (“CA”) is a leading global investment firm. CA’s goal is to help endowments & foundations, pension plans, and ultra-high net worth private clients implement and manage custom investment portfolios that generate outperformance so that they can maximize their impact on the world. Cambridge Associates delivers a range of services, including outsourced CIO, non-discretionary portfolio management, and investment consulting.

Head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, CA has offices in key markets in North America, the United Kingdom, Europe, Asia, and Oceania. Our worldwide teams ensure our clients benefit from decades of global presence, local expertise, and relationships with the top global investment managers across the world. Position Overview:

The Client Reporting group is tasked with supporting the firm’s investment practice through the production of monthly and quarterly performance reports. The group offers three performance report products including total portfolio, hedge funds, and private investments – publishing approximately 17,000 reports annually. CA’s investment teams use the reports as a tool to analyze asset allocations and total performance returns of various investment managers and to provide information on the investment strategy applied by each fund. The reports also assist our clients in making decisions about their portfolio structures. Client Reporting team members are focused on efficiently producing high-quality products and providing superior customer service to the CA investment teams they support.

Analysts in the Client Reporting group are responsible for all aspects of performance report production; including data input, exhibit generation, quality control, and client portfolio administration. The position is operations focused and includes back to middle office responsibilities to support CA’s multiple services. The Analyst, Client Reporting role is a great entry into the financial services industry and provides a wealth of opportunities to develop professional skills in a fast-paced and dynamic work environment.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Assume ownership and accountability for the generation and delivery of monthly and quarterly performance reports to investment teams for multiple client assignments
  • Input data into proprietary database and maintain high accuracy of reports through extensive quality checking procedures
  • Reconcile and track all money movements within client portfolios (e.g., investment manager subscriptions/redemptions, cash flows, private investment commitments, spending) through communication with internal and external parties
  • Compare product returns to benchmarks; analyze and document any variances in the reported figures
  • Create and maintain custom benchmarks
  • Proactively communicate and address requests related to investment performance, deviations from benchmarks and asset allocation targets, and portfolio movements to CA investment teams
  • Fulfill time-sensitive data requests and provide professional customer service to CA investment teams and clients
  • Based on a thorough understanding of individual client needs, provide recommendations to investment teams for displaying performance results through the performance reporting products
  • Other duties as assigned, as earned, and as the group evolves
